The International Association "CAUCASUS: Ethnic Relations, Human Rights, Geopolitics" (IACERHRG) is a Non-governmental, Non-profit, public, scientific and educational organization. The Association was founded on October 29, 1998, in Tbilisi (Capital of the Republic of Georgia). Main goals of IACERHRG are: 1. Permanent monitoring of the Human Rights situation in the Republic of Georgia and the Caucasus; 2. Study the Ethnic Relations and Conflicts in the Caucasus; 3. Study the questions of the Caucasian Geopolitics; 4. Study the history of Georgia and the Caucasus; 5. Study the history of Human Rights movement in the Caucasus; 6. Study the problems of the Rights of the Nations (Peoples); 7. Study the history of the Intercultural Relations of the Caucasian Peoples; 8.
